Output 08b533922cd6f4e3e1089ab69b1a44fc69f4e41e262e3f69c69cb7633ef22db7:14

value
35008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dc944f189a7fcedf888a337c6420d57b41f2ffe OP_EQUAL
address
3LT7ZJh95BA2UvJeb5V6K7HBwoTdYtpAZ1
transaction
08b533922cd6f4e3e1089ab69b1a44fc69f4e41e262e3f69c69cb7633ef22db7
confirmations
177017
spent
true